    For the driving dodger, feeding visionary or illusive finisher, the Optik 3 combines features best suited for those quickest around the crease. An increased offset, dual-strut sidewall and optimal face shape strike a perfect balance to catch, carry and control with brilliance. Additionally for those who initiate the offense, a shortened throat rewards players with unmatched top hand control.  Now with 20 sidewall holes, the stringing options are limitless.

    As a general rule how do you measure the length of string for your side walls and top string?

    • @redstarlacrosse
      @redstarlacrosse  Před 3 lety +1

      I hold one end of the string, stretch my arm all the way out to the side, and measure to the middle of my chest. That always works for my top strings, and sidewalls.
